The ultimate aim of oilfield development is improved oil recovery by an economical method. For water drive oilfield, with water cut increasing and oil production decreasing, we have to take some measures such as fracturing, water shut off, re-perforating, layering and modification of injection pattern. But with oil field developing, measure potential is becoming less in basic well pattern. Especially to low permeability oil field, due to poor sandstone continuity, low permeability and porosity, oil and liquid PI have a sharp drop after production well water flooded. This takes a serious threaten on production rate maintenance. Low permeability oil field's development have proved that increasing well density, and at the same time, decreasing well spacing to a reasonable level can improve well pattern dominate capability and water drive efficiency, thereby improve whole development level.Aiming at Shengping oil field low recovery percent, production rate, composite water cut and far well spacing, by untabulated reservoir well testing, development potential analyses and a series of important measures analyses, this paper takes infilled well pattern to improve oil field developing efficiency. During of project's drawing up and implement, we carry out fine reservoir description, remaining oil distribution feature research. These works make us realize reservoir producing situation in an all-round way and draw up reasonable infilled project. Finally this project gains a quite well effect. At the same time, to low permeability oil field of Daqing periphery district, this project provides valuable experience and technology.
